NEW COURSES F. KIN 049 Basic Firefighter Physical Fitness The committee agreed to approve KIN 049 as a new course. The corequisite was also approved. COURSE ID: KIN 149 COURSE TITLE: Basic Firefighter Physical Fitness PREREQUISITE: None COREQUISITE: FIRET 115 DEPARTMENTAL RECOMMENDATION: None SEMESTER UNITS: 2 MINIMUM SEMESTER HOURS: LECTURE: 8 LAB: 72 CATALOG DESCRIPTION: Physical fitness exercise, team work, disciplined precision cadence drilling and preparation for the fire agility physical fitness testing requirement for fire academy cadets. Graded on a Pass or No Pass basis only. SCHEDULE DESCRIPTION: Physical fitness exercise, team work, disciplined precision cadence drilling and preparation for the fire agility physical fitness testing requirement for fire academy cadets. KIN 200 Introduction to Kinesiology The committee agreed to approve KIN 200 as a new course. COURSE ID: KIN 200 COURSE TITLE: Introduction to Kinesiology PREREQUISITE: None COREQUISITE: None Curriculum Committee Page 2
3 DEPARTMENTAL RECOMMENDATION: None SEMESTER UNITS: 3 MINIMUM SEMESTER HOURS: LECTURE: 48 CATALOG DESCRIPTION: Introduction to the interdisciplinary study of human movement. Study of the historical development, philosophies and methods of the discipline, and career opportunities in the areas of teaching, coaching, athletic training, exercise science, fitness, and health promotion professions. SCHEDULE DESCRIPTION: Introduction to the interdisciplinary study of human movement. L. KIN 231 First Aid and CPR The committee agreed to approve KIN 231 as a new course. COURSE ID: KIN 231 COURSE TITLE: First Aid and CPR PREREQUISITE: None COREQUISITE: None DEPARTMENTAL RECOMMENDATION: None SEMESTER UNITS: 3 MINIMUM SEMESTER HOURS: LECTURE: 48 CATALOG DESCRIPTION: Provides instruction on emergency care and treatment of illnesses and injuries including training in c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) and automated external defibrillation (AED). Students who successfully pass all National Safety Council requirements will receive a First Aid Certificate. Students who successfully pass all CPR and AED requirements will receive a CPR/AED Certificate. SCHEDULE DESCRIPTION: Provides instruction on emergency care and treatment of illnesses and injuries including training in CPR and AED. M.
